About the Dual Immersion Program

Dual Immersion is a challenging and rigorous academic program that begins in TK/Kindergarten and continues through the fifth grade. Spanish is the target language of instruction. Students learn Spanish in TK-2 grades and master the Spanish skills to add on the English language skills at third grade and beyond.

Program Goals

The Dual Immersion Program holds an added value of rigor, preparing students for participation in world-class language development from their elementary years and continuing through middle school and Temescal High School's prestigious International Baccalaureate Program and Diploma.
 
The goals of Railroad Canyon's DI Program are to develop:
  • High levels of proficiency in reading, writing, listening, and speaking in two languages
  • High academic performance in all content areas
  • A deep understanding and appreciation of cultures
  • Skills in cross cultural communication and a sense of global citizenship
  • The ability to study and communicate across the curriculum in two languages
The diagram below illustrates how language instruction shifts from Spanish immersion to English & Spanish between grades K-5. Language courses are offered in middle school and high school to reinforce a student's Spanish speaking skills, to build Spanish literacy. Once a student reaches the senior year of high school, special honors, such as the state Seal of Biliteracy diploma recognition, may be awarded to students who successfully demonstrate language proficiency.
 

 

% Spanish

% English

K

90%

10%

1

90%

10%

2

80%

20%

3

70%

30%

4

50%

50%

5

50%

50%
